Alternative Investment Solutions

State Street's Alternative Investment Solutions group provides a complete suite of services to more than 750 clients, including institutional investors, hedge fund managers, private equity fund managers and real estate fund managers. We offer deep, product-specific expertise in alternative investments and flexible, innovative alternative investment solutions, including fund accounting, fund administration, corporate administration, risk and credit services.

Alternative Investment Administration Services

The AIAS team is focused on providing administrative and analytical solutions to institutional investors in Private Equity and Real Estate. Our team tracks all communications from our clients' General Partners, processes all cash movements, updates investment valuations, captures underlying portfolio company and property details, and provides online tools for performance and exposure reporting.
